student researchers have been walking the woods of nova scotia this spring and summer collecting ticks in the first year of a five-year study designed to provide more information on what the parasites are doing and where.
laura ferguson, a professor in acadia university’s biology department, is leading the project. she said students are dragging one-metre-square white flannel sheets while walking along paths.
“we drag them through leaf litter and grassy areas and small shrubbery,” ferguson said.
the students will walk a 300-metre stretch, stopping every 25 metres to collect any ticks that have attached themselves to the blanket.
“we’re mainly looking for the black-legged ticks; we’re also collecting dog ticks, which are the two main species that we find,” said ferguson.
they’re collecting at as many sites as they can across mainland nova scotia. cape breton’s tick populations are lower so it isn’t part of the initial year of the study because of cost and time constraints.
the students are targeting walking trails where people would be out regularly, and drag each site every two weeks.
“all of that is going to tell us a lot about how much variation there is in tick abundance across different locations across the province,” ferguson said.
“all of those ticks will get tested for the pathogens that they might be carrying, and then we can look to see if there are differences in the level of those pathogens in different parts of the province.”

she said they expect to find some variation and can use that information to update the province’s public health agency about higher-risk areas.
after that, the team will try to figure out why there are variations.
“we’re also going to be looking for trace remnants of dna in the ticks left over from the last blood meal that they took, and see if the feeding patterns – mice, squirrel deer, birds and so on – vary across the province.”
